Senses
да́ма is used for these senses in English:
- draughts (board games, UK, Irish, Commonwealth, uncountable) A board game for two players in which the players each have a set number of pieces (typically 12 or 20, depending on the rule set), known as men, and the object is to capture each of the opponent's pieces by jumping one's own pieces over the opponent's pieces.
- hopscotch (playground games) A child's game, in which a player, hopping on one foot, drives a stone from one compartment to another of a figure traced or scotched on the ground.
- lady A woman of breeding or higher class, a woman of authority.
- queen (cards) A playing card with a depiction of a queen on it, generally ranking next below the king and above the jack in a given suit.
- queen (chess) A chess piece that, under contemporary rules, is the most powerful, able to move any number of spaces horizontally, vertically, or diagonally.
